Tensions between tennis players and the Grand Slams escalated at the French Open on Friday, as Novak Djokovic warned the sport risked deeper divisions amid growing demands for fairer revenue sharing and greater player influence. Several stars ditched media commitments in a show of solidarity, though many were cautious about the prospect of a boycott after Aryna Sabalenka raised the possibility earlier this month.
